As women age, managing reproductive health becomes increasingly important. Regular check-ups with your GP can help monitor changes in your reproductive system. Be aware of changes in your menstrual cycle, as irregularities can indicate underlying health issues. Additionally, discussing family planning and fertility options with a healthcare provider can help you make informed decisions. Nutritional choices, such as a bal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als, play a vital role in maintaining reproductive health. Staying active through regular exercise can also support overall well-being. Don't hesitate to seek support from healthcare professionals if you have concerns about your reproductive health as you age.
